      *RAFA BENITEZ emphasised why Liverpool need more fire-power before the start of the season after seeing his side lose its second friendly in a week.

      The Anfield boss continues to trail Feyenoord's Dirk Kuyt, with a fresh approach for the Dutchman imminent.

      It's understood Kuyt has made it clear to his club he wants to move to Merseyside, despite interest from Manchester United.

      Liverpool have already had one offer for Kuyt turned down, and Benitez knows funds must be generated if he's to make a successful bid*
